Time Conundrums
Time travel, a staple of science fiction, poses numerous paradoxes that challenge our notions of causality and reality. One of the most famous time travel paradoxes is the grandfather paradox, where a time traveler goes back in time and prevents their own grandfather from meeting their grandmother, thereby preventing their own existence. This paradox highlights the complexities and contradictions inherent in altering the past.

The Butterfly Effect
Coined from chaos theory, the Butterfly Effect suggests that small changes can have significant and far-reaching consequences. The idea is that a butterfly flapping its wings in one part of the world could set off a chain reaction of events that ultimately leads to a tornado in another part of the world. This concept underscores the interconnectedness of all things and the sensitivity of complex systems to initial conditions.
